Hey guys I got my sensativity knob from whites today. I tried to install it and now My M6 detector dont work right. I have everything plugged in right that I know of and if you turn the knobs up it makes a noise but its like the coil dont work. When I turn the sensitivity up at one certain spot as I turn it makes a loud on and in and out noise constantly wont shut up. If I move it a tad bit over from that spot it dont do anything... any ideas
